Bill for opening up more for blue collar job needs more reform before it gets passed

The bill on opening more for blue collar jobs is being discussed in Japan parliament. The opposition parties and also activists are demanding more reforms in favor (more pay scales & PR) of the foreign workers before it should get passed.
As per the report,
Some one opposition party are bit in opposition to passing the bill since in the past there have been cases where interns (non-Indians) were exploited for time and went unpaid for overtime when it started from 1993.
Under the one if the activities under “Skill Development” program of Indian Government.
But Indians preparing and participating as an interns have been recent and so far no such reported from Indian interns. Also lot of work reformed have taken in recent history of japan, so Organizations selected by Indian government are still optimistic about it and are in favor that there is a lot of scope for interns to come to Japan. It might take some time to develop but things might change for good in future.
